Timeline of astronomical maps, catalogs, and surveys
Timeline
of
astronomical maps
, catalogs and surveys
134 BC
-
Hipparchus
makes a detailed
star map[?]
1678
-
Edmund Halley
publishes a catalog of 341 southern stars---first systematic southern sky survey
1771
-
Charles Messier
publishes his first list of
nebulae
1864
-
John Herschel
publishes the
General Catalog[?]
of nebulae and star clusters
1890
-
John Dreyer[?]
publishes the New General Catalog of nebulae and star clusters
1956
- Completion of the
Palomar sky survey[?]
with the Palomar 48-inch Schmidt optical reflecting telescope
1962
-
A.S. Bennett[?]
publishes the Revised 3C Catalog of 328 radio sources
1965
-
Gerry Neugebauer[?]
and
Robert Leighton[?]
begin a 2.2 micron sky survey with a 1.6-meter telescope on Mount Wilson
1993
- Start of the 20 cm VLA FIRST survey
